Paid Study Leave. Paid study leaves for purposes of professional development, such as a specialized training program, may be granted to a member of the bargaining unit provided such leave contributes toward the member’s effectiveness and value to his/her current position. Paid Study Leaves may also be granted for professional development opportunities that contribute to a management approved career goal with the College. Paid Study Leave is not appropriate when management is requiring the employee to attend training. The criteria and conditions for Paid Study Leaves are as follow:
